Soneva explodes with colour

Soneva explodes with colour

Soneva, a leading luxury resort operator, introduces the “Festival of Colour”, its first-ever year-long campaign celebrating the diverse array of guest activities and experiences on offer this year, ranging from visiting Michelin-starred chefs and astronomers, through to authors, champion free-divers, artists and more.

Each month of the year is associated with a different colour and theme, which will be brought to life at Soneva’s resorts in the Maldives and Thailand through special on-site events and collaborations.

Underscoring the Festival of Colour is a series of short “colour” films created by the renowned French film director Bruno Aveillan. Aveillan visited Soneva Fushi and Soneva Jani in early 2017 to shoot the films, which were inspired by the different colours he found at the resorts. Soneva plans to release one colour film each month during the campaign on its website and on social media.

As part of the campaign, Soneva has confirmed a huge line-up of visiting experts, including chefs, authors, wine producers, world-champion free-divers, astronomers, artists, wellness practitioners, tennis coaches and more at all resorts.

So far, 28 of the world’s top chefs have confirmed they will present their culinary experiences at exclusive dinner events. Among the confirmed chefs are Tom Aikens, Wilco Berends, Benoit Dewitte, Jarno Eggen, Jos Grootscholten, Michael Husken, Mark Lundgaard, Gert De Mangeleer, Ton Tassanakajohn and Eric Yu.

“We’re really focused on crafting these beautiful, beyond bespoke experiences where discovery is a way of life. With our expert hosts as personal guides, we invite our guests to explore and delight in experiences that will last a lifetime,” said Sonu Shivdasani, founder and CEO of Soneva.

In addition to chefs, other experts include renowned British historian Andrew Roberts, world-champion free-diver Umberto Pelizzari, astronomer Massimo Terenghi, plus glass artists James Devereux and Louis Thompson, among many others.

Guests who visit any Soneva property during the Festival of Colour will be treated to special colour-themed movie screenings, cocktails, canapes and more. There will also be announcements over the next few months linked to new restaurant openings and new guest experiences, all linked to different colour themes.

Soneva’s Festival of Colour runs from this month until February 2019.
